Resistance: the ceiling price keeps hitting

Resistance is support's mirror image: a price the stock has struggled to push through, usually because people who bought at that level are relieved to get their money back and sell.

The more times a level holds, the more attention it gets — and the bigger the reaction when it finally gives way.

A clean break above resistance on heavy volume is treated as meaningful; a break on quiet trading often fails.
